An entry of just 12 players competed in a 3-round Swiss-McMahon tournament for the title of 4th Royston Open Shogi Champion at the Coombes Community Centre on September 1st 1990. As in previous years, the event attracted a strong field, averaging stronger than 2-kyu, from the South-East counties, ranging from Doug McGown, 7-kyu, from Shepperton, to David Murphy, 3-dan British Champion, from Orpington.
At the same time as the Shogi competition was being played, a parallel 5-round Tori-Shogi competition was run, attracting just 6 players, of whom 2 opted to play simultaneously in both tournaments! The last Tori-Shogi tournament to be staged in Britain was held in February 1985 in Oxford when Matthew MacFadyen beat 5 other players to claim the unofficial title of "British Tori Champion"! That tournament was also the 1st Tori-Shogi tournament to be staged in this country. The Royston event attracted entries from as far away as Ashford, Bristol and Oxford, as well as a "home" representative from Royston.
In the Shogi tournament 6 players won 2 out of 3 games and the title had to be decided on a tie-break. The reigning Royston Open Shogi Champion, Les Blackstock, retained his title by winning the last game to finish in the final round! In the Tori tournament the title was awarded to David Murphy, who was placed 2nd in the Shogi Tournament! David won all 5 Tori-Shogi games, but again the last game to finish in the final round, against Richard West of Royston, was the deciding match! David now claims to be the unofficial "British Tori Champion"! Both champions have been invited back to Royston in 1991 to defend their titles.
